In the second quarter of 2023, the unemployment rate in Russia was the highest in the North Caucasian Federal District at nearly 10 percent. The lowest figure was recorded in the Ural Federal District at 2.4 percent. In the second and third quarters of 2020, unemployment sharply increased in the country due to the crisis caused by the coronavirus (COVID-19) pandemic.
